      The clash at Chengdu Phoenix Hill brings together the league leaders and a Shenhua side heavily affected by its points deduction. Chengdu have 48 points from 14 wins, six draws and three defeats, while Shenhua have 25 points from 10 wins, five draws and eight defeats. The historical record gives Chengdu another reason for confidence. They have won five of nine meetings, while Shenhua have only one victory. Chengdu are unbeaten in the last three encounters, including a 1-0 home win in 2025 and a 3-2 victory in Shanghai in May 2026. Shenhua, however, should not be underestimated. They finished second in the Chinese Super League in both 2024 and 2025, collecting 77 and 64 points respectively. Their 42 goals in 23 league games this season also show that their attacking threat remains significant. The decisive factor could therefore be match tempo.
